Commit Graph

2212 Commits

Author SHA1 Message Date
Philip Eisenlohr d374f6a02c revert, since not working in python3.8... 2022-11-18 11:01:01 -05:00
Philip Eisenlohr 822a098659 cleaner way to specify default dict entries 2022-11-18 10:06:15 -05:00
Philip Eisenlohr 045f1d39a1 add shorthand function for formatting 2022-11-14 14:52:07 -05:00
Philip Eisenlohr 2e7d59ab43 brief but comprehensive "is_complete" reporting 2022-11-11 18:07:48 -05:00
Sharan Roongta 4fc5ba54df dummy phase dict need to be added for any new material added (similar to dream3D) 2022-11-11 18:47:01 +01:00
Sharan 13df12be1b initialising dummy arguments with None, making few changes on what is_complete should do 2022-11-11 01:54:59 +01:00
Sharan Roongta 443d796643 phase and homogenization dict to be updated when new material added 2022-11-09 23:13:45 +01:00
Philip Eisenlohr b5b861afdd Merge branch 'result-export-DADF5' into 'development'
export to new DADF5 file

See merge request damask/DAMASK!644
2022-11-08 19:01:48 +00:00
Martin Diehl 4f0db64e15 grid assemble + corrected grid.scale 2022-11-08 18:52:08 +00:00
Martin Diehl 59150b791f support the user 2022-11-08 12:39:38 +01:00
Philip Eisenlohr 868a4dda96 remove numpy where unnecessary 2022-11-07 14:56:38 -05:00
Sharan Roongta 88206d307b default was incorrect and some useful examples added 2022-11-07 18:30:46 +01:00
Philip Eisenlohr 13d0f3ae8a more precise description of `times_in_range` 2022-11-07 12:21:26 -05:00
Philip Eisenlohr f88ac18c8a consistent "optional" in parameter description 2022-11-07 12:18:00 -05:00
Martin Diehl 015f1ec741 possibility to export into new DADF5 file 2022-11-07 10:10:13 +01:00
Martin Diehl 0fa9631675 testing output of export_result 2022-11-06 23:16:30 +01:00
Daniel Otto de Mentock 2c3da9c1bf added custom path export option to Result.export_* functions 2022-11-06 18:10:23 +00:00
Martin Diehl 8caf09aff7 correct inclusion of dependencies 2022-10-12 08:01:33 +02:00
Martin Diehl 14c46d4c2e typo 2022-10-11 07:43:05 +02:00
Daniel Otto de Mentock 580e01bd1c fix grid add primitive bug 2022-08-29 11:44:50 +00:00
Martin Diehl 31fe894c78 Merge branch 'docstring-polishing' into 'development'
increasing consistency

See merge request damask/DAMASK!616
2022-08-17 04:41:11 +00:00
Martin Diehl 7530d457a2 documenting new behavior 2022-08-15 08:04:02 +02:00
Philip Eisenlohr ef8891797a Merge branch 'development' into empty-table-init 2022-08-12 16:15:33 -04:00
Daniel Otto de Mentock 400323a9aa Modified shapeshifter function 2022-08-12 18:45:40 +00:00
Martin Diehl b7cd0c1d51 increasing consistency 2022-08-10 20:51:50 +02:00
Daniel Otto de Mentock 66f129273c Merge branch 'magic_methods_default_docstrings' into 'development'
Added standard magic method descriptions to magic methods

Closes #112

See merge request damask/DAMASK!606
2022-08-10 15:35:56 +00:00
Philip Eisenlohr 009320c9fc polishing of doc-strings 2022-08-09 09:29:22 -04:00
Martin Diehl fb38340184 glitch in example 2022-07-27 12:56:37 +02:00
Martin Diehl 44d9663ff0 standard name 2022-07-26 21:55:17 +02:00
d.mentock 3492dfcd3b Adding consistency to docstring structure 2022-07-08 18:07:07 +02:00
d.mentock df1f362ed3 it's useful for users to see standard docstrings in magic methods 2022-07-08 18:06:41 +02:00
Philip Eisenlohr 7082eab366 small test to demonstrate alternative Table init 2022-07-08 18:01:36 +02:00
d.mentock 77fa2a1d93 adjustments to patchfile required for marc2021/2022 spack packages 2022-06-15 15:48:34 +02:00
Daniel Otto de Mentock 1328235192 Merge branch 'util_module_import_style' into 'development'
util: module visibility

Closes #150

See merge request damask/DAMASK!603
2022-06-13 09:06:04 +00:00
Martin Diehl 1a44b6e692 white space adjustments 2022-06-10 14:03:43 +02:00
d.mentock d88a139a41 pyflakes bug causes error without comment 2022-06-10 12:03:50 +02:00
d.mentock afbafd1d98 util imports need prefix instead of __all__ definition to prevent namespace pollution 2022-06-10 12:00:54 +02:00
Martin Diehl bcd3d00960 fixed test
this tests should ensure that each Orientation has exactly one symmetrically
equivalent representation. It was not fully correct before and works as expected
after 8fefc46f38
2022-06-10 09:26:15 +02:00
Martin Diehl cdd3b44519 using more precise coefficients also in test
changes in _rotation.py are just cosmetic
2022-06-09 23:54:56 +02:00
Philip Eisenlohr d10516e0b6 fixed typo 2022-06-09 17:23:16 -04:00
Philip Eisenlohr 8fefc46f38 fixed FZ conditions and tightened tolerance to accommodate higher precision "tfit" 2022-06-09 16:38:13 -04:00
Daniel Otto de Mentock 49e40923e5 Merge branch 'numpy_dtype_int_to_int64' into 'development'
Prevent windows overflow error when using numpy dtype=int instead of int64

Closes #175

See merge request damask/DAMASK!598
2022-06-07 10:46:50 +00:00
Philip Eisenlohr 40658a6645 fixed typo in Result.view example 2022-06-05 21:39:06 +00:00
d.mentock b9214fcc6c Prevent windows overflow error when using numpy dtype=int instead of int64 2022-06-02 19:40:18 +02:00
Philip Eisenlohr b7d807db01 re-added default arguments that got lost in last commit 2022-05-25 09:45:37 -04:00
Philip Eisenlohr 4746ac890b Merge branch 'development' into 'empty-table-init'
# Conflicts:
#   python/damask/_table.py
2022-05-25 13:29:23 +00:00
Philip Eisenlohr 1dc5e353c4 Merge branch 'sequence-not-iterable' into 'development'
Need sequence not iterable

See merge request damask/DAMASK!587
2022-05-25 13:25:25 +00:00
Martin Diehl b9cea941cc simplified 2022-05-23 10:37:57 +02:00
Martin Diehl 4b4b455b85 mypy does not understand the setter 2022-05-22 10:08:32 +02:00
Martin Diehl 8039e56882 Merge remote-tracking branch 'origin/development' into typehints_results 2022-05-21 17:46:59 +02:00